Waterville Priest Accused of Sexual Abuse of a Minor

The Diocese of Portland says there has been a substantiated claim of sexual abuse against a pastor of St. Joseph Maronite Church in Waterville.

Jensen is not a priest of the Diocese of Portland. The St. Joseph Maronite Church is part of the Eparchy of Saint Maron of Brooklyn, which stretches from Maine to Florida.

The diocese says it was notified by Bishop Gregory John Mansour, the bishop of the Eparchy of Saint Maron of Brooklyn.

Church leaders say the incident took place between 2000 and 2003, while Father Jensen was a pastor at a parish in Danbury, Conn.

He has worked in Waterville since 2006. There are no other known allegations of sexual abuse against him.

A representative from the Eparchy said the alleged victim is a male and that Father Jensen told the church official he was not aware the victim was underage.

"When I spoke to Father Larry, who was very cooperative, might I add, he said that he just assumed the person was eighteen," said Chorbishop Michael Thomas of the Eparchy of St. Maron of Brooklyn.

"It seems that it was definitely a consensual thing, and I don't consider Father Larry to be a predator but nonetheless he was the priest and he was older and should have known to say no, that's the bottom line."

A representative from the church came to Waterville over the weekend to explain the situation to members of the church and that Father Jensen would not be returning.

They appointed a new pastor and asked if anyone knows of an incident of sexual abuse to come forward.
